How to get time elapsed in milliseconds


Since performance of string concatenation is quite weak in VB6 I'm testing several StringBuilder implementations. To see how long they're running, I currently use the built-in

Timer

function which only gives me the number of seconds that have passed after midnight.

Is there a way (I guess by importing a system function) to get something with milliseconds precision?


Solution

  • Yes, you can use the Win32 API:

    DWORD WINAPI GetTickCount(void);
    

    To import it in VB6 declare it like this:

    Private Declare Function GetTickCount Lib "kernel32" () As Long
    

    Call it before the operation and after and then calculate the difference in time passed.
